Compact 2-way cabinet with natural and direct sound quality. It has a 18db/octave filter with a passive limiter. It is equipped with a titanium dome high driver. The horn can be rotated if you like to use the speaker horizontal. Due to the natural frequency response it has a high gain before feedback. The 90° x 60° horn gives an even coverage and smooth response, on and off axis. The XT-10 MKII is finished with scratch resistant black spray.
The DAP X-series is a successful speaker range since 2006. They have proven their reliability, sound quality and high power handling for many years now. DAP audio has upgraded the looks with the XT series, the metal grill made it more road-proof and more stylish. Now DAP audio again improved this range by using a better scratch resistant paint and reducing the weight of the complete range. Also the XT MKII is better protected against overload and gives the sound more definition and less distortion in high frequencies when playing on max power.

Because the TOA T-650 speaker employs a horn for short distance coverage and a horn for long distance coverage, it ensures high intelligibility even in sports facilities or public halls where many reverberations are generated. The speaker is designed to be installed as a main speaker in small and intermediate indoor sports facilities, and its heavy-duty construction protects unit against impacts from balls and other objects.

The C3110 is a full range extremely versatile wide-dispersion, low profile, two-way loudspeaker system for near field applications.
Its compact size makes it ideal for low visibility side wall mounting.The high-frequency section is a constant directivity horn loaded to a 1” Neodymium compression driver with a 1.5” diaphragm assembly for smooth, wide dispersion.
The low-frequency transducer is a 10” woofer with a 2” voice coil.
